Three agencies are investigating an attack made on a watchman who frightened a robber attempting to break in the Gus Ward restaurant, located about half way between Lugoff and Blaney in Kershaw county.
A white man had rented a tourist cottage near the restaurant and struck the watchman, who was preparing to start a fire. The watchmen was rendered unconscious and the intruder removed a window glass from the restaurant in attempt to gain entrance.
By the time, the watchman recovered consciousness and opened fire on the would-be robber, frightening him from the premises. The watchman required hospital treatment after the incident.
Sheriff J. H. McLeod is investigating the case for Kershaw county.
L. B. Shealy of the governor’s office and Assistant Investigator J. W. Richardson of the state patrol yesterday morning visited the scene of the attack and gathered evidence.
